Overview This page contains the latest trade data of Mate. In 2023, Mate were the world's 3625th most traded product, with a total trade of $212M. Between 2022 and 2023 the exports of Mate decreased by -6.35%, from $226M to $212M. Trade in Mate represent 0.00094% of total world trade.
Mate are a part of Mate.
Exports In 2023 the top exporters of Mate were Brazil ($92.3M), Argentina ($86.3M), Paraguay ($13.3M), Syria ($5.69M), and Germany ($2.23M).
Imports In 2023 the top importers of Mate were Uruguay ($65M), Syria ($63.2M), Argentina ($14.9M), Chile ($10.5M), and Spain ($10.1M).
